How to Duplicate a Page in WordPress
Duplicating a page in WordPress is a straightforward process. By following these simple steps, you can quickly create a copy of an existing page or post on your website.
Log into Your WordPress Dashboard
To begin, log in to your WordPress admin dashboard using your username and password. This is where you’ll access all the tools and settings needed to duplicate your page.
Navigate to the Pages or Posts Section
Depending on whether you want to duplicate a page or a post, navigate to the “Pages” or “Posts” section in the left-hand menu. Click on it to proceed.
Select the Page You Want to Duplicate
From the list of pages or posts, find the one you wish to duplicate. Hover your mouse cursor over it, and you’ll see several options appear beneath the title. Click on “Clone” or “Duplicate,” depending on the plugin or theme you’re using.
Edit the Duplicated Page
After clicking “Clone” or “Duplicate,” you will be redirected to the editing screen for the duplicated page. Here, you can make any necessary changes or updates to the content, title, or featured image of the new page.
Publish or Save the Duplicated Page
Once you’re satisfied with the changes, click “Publish” to make the duplicated page live on your website. Alternatively, you can choose to save it as a draft for further editing or scheduling it for future publication.
Review Your New Page
To ensure everything looks as intended, visit the front end of your website and navigate to the duplicated page. Verify that all elements and content have been accurately duplicated.
Advantages of Duplicating Pages in WordPress
Duplicating pages in WordPress offers several advantages that can greatly benefit website owners and content creators. Let’s explore some of these benefits:
1. Time Efficiency
Duplicating pages saves you time and effort, especially when creating multiple similar pages or posts. Instead of starting from scratch, you can replicate the structure and content of an existing page, making the process much faster.
2. Consistency
Maintaining a consistent look and feel across your website is crucial for branding and user experience. Duplicating pages ensures that you maintain a consistent design and layout, which can be particularly useful for product pages, service descriptions, or event announcements.
3. A/B Testing
For those involved in online marketing, A/B testing is a common practice to optimize page performance. Duplicating pages allows you to create variations of a page to test different headlines, images, or call-to-action buttons, helping you identify what works best for your audience.
4. Content Templates
If you frequently create similar types of content, such as product descriptions or event announcements, duplicating pages can serve as a template. You can keep the essential structure and elements intact while customizing the specific details for each new piece of content.
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Can I duplicate a page without using a plugin?
A: Yes, while many plugins offer this functionality, some WordPress themes come with built-in page duplication options. However, using a plugin is generally more flexible and recommended.
Q: Will duplicating a page affect my SEO rankings?
A: Duplicating a page itself does not directly impact SEO rankings. However, it’s essential to update the content, meta information, and URLs of the duplicated page to avoid duplicate content issues.
Q: Are there any limitations to duplicating pages in WordPress?
A: Some plugins or themes may have limitations on the number of pages you can duplicate or may not support certain types of content. It’s essential to choose a plugin that suits your needs.
Q: Can I duplicate pages for different languages on a multilingual website?
A: Yes, duplicating pages is beneficial for creating content in multiple languages. You can duplicate the original page and then translate the duplicated version to maintain consistency.
Q: Is it possible to revert to the original page if needed?
A: Yes, you can always revert to the original page by deleting the duplicated version or restoring a previous version of the page from the WordPress revision history.
Q: What are some popular WordPress plugins for duplicating pages?
A: Some widely used plugins for duplicating pages in WordPress include “Duplicate Page,” “Yoast Duplicate Post,” and “Post Duplicator.”
